A recruitment agency specializing in Hospitality, Tourism & Leisure identifies, assesses and places executives, managers and directors for hotels, travel groups, tourist attractions and restaurant chains.

According to France Travail's 2026 survey, the hospitality and catering sector accounts for 319,000 recruitment projects in France, 44% of which are considered hard to fill. This level of pressure confirms that recruiting executives and managers in this sector can no longer rely solely on traditional channels.

Seasonality, candidates' geographic mobility and strong competition among employers make recruitment as much a strategic issue as an operational one for this sector.

What is the difference between permanent recruitment and an executive search assignment for a leadership position?

For an executive or manager position, our permanent recruitment division draws on a pool of active candidates, generally allowing for a shorter timeframe. For a general management position or a Comex/Codir mandate, our headhunters apply a dedicated search methodology: complete market mapping, direct approach to candidates who are not actively looking, and a structured leadership assessment. The level of responsibility of the position determines the most suitable approach.

How do I choose an outplacement company?

The aim of any outplacement company is to find you a new job.

When chosen well, outplacement offers true added value; even if the methods vary, companies provide greatly similar services. So how do I choose my outplacement company? 

1.What type of employee is the outplacement intended for?

Reserved until now for executive leaders, in terms of cost, outplacement is becoming more accessible and offered more and more frequently to middle management roles by companies keen to preserve their good employer image. At Morgan Philips we offer methods suited to each employee level, from executives to middle management and regular staff. 

2. How much and who pays? 

Companies’ fees vary, but in general they are between 15 and 20% of the gross annual salary. At Morgan Philips our fees are between 10 and 15% of the gross annual salary.
